Population

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Population 210,075 2,949,037 334,821,731
Population density (per sq mi) 213.3 60.8 85.8
Population growth (%/yr) 0.79% -0.18% 0.57%
Median age 35.6 36.3 37.1
Households 81,210 1,131,698 128,459,983

Economy

Harrison County has a the economy index of D, which means it is barely prosperous.

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Median household income $57,944 $55,084 $78,145
Income growth (%/yr) 4.35% 4.47% 5.07%
Unemployment rate 7.2% 5.9% 5.2%

Housing

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Median home price $174,954 $119,791 $242,182
Median rent $1,074 $923 $1,342
Homeownership rate 60.6% 69.5% 65.1%

Mobility & Commuting

The most common departure window is 07:00 AM – 07:29 AM , followed by 06:30 AM – 06:59 AM .

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Average commute time (min) 20.8 21.4 22.5
Work from home 5.7% 5.3% 13.4%

Education & Households

Harrison County has a education index of D, which means it is barely educated.

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Bachelor's degree or higher 22.8% 21.7% 31.6%
Average household size 2.53 2.52 2.54

Health

Harrison County has a health index of C, which means it is somewhat healthy.

Metric Harrison County Mississippi Avg U.S. Average
Life expectancy (years) 73.9 74.7 78.3
Self-rated poor health 18.9% 23.5% 16.3%
Smokers 20.4% 22.1% 19.0%
